SolidWorks 入门笔记03:生成工程图和一键标注
默认情况下,SOLIDWORKS系统在工程图和零件或装配体三维模型之间提供全相关的功能,全相关意味着无论什么时候修改零件或装配体的三维模型,所有相关的工程视图将自动更新,以反映零件或装配体的形状和尺寸变化;反之,当在一个工程图中修改一个零件或装配体尺寸时,系统也将自动地更新相关的其他工程视图及三维零件或装配体中的相应尺寸。
在安装SOLIDWORKS软件时,可以设定工程图与三维模型间的单向链接关系,这样当在工程图中对尺寸进行了修改时,三维模型并不更新。如果要改变此设置,只有再重新安装一次软件。此外,SOLIDWORKS系统提供多种类型的图形文件输出格式,包括最常用的DWG和DXF格式以及其他几种常用的标准格式。
工程图包含一个或多个由零件或装配体生成的视图。在生成工程图之前,必须先保存与它有关的零件或装配体的三维模型。
1. 创建工程图
1.1 从零件制作工程图



1.2 一键标注
首先摆放好所需要的三个视图,然后点击界面左上方的【注解】-【模型项目】,进入模型项目属性设置界面。

来源选择【整个模型】,尺寸选择1、2、3选项后点击绿色勾【确认】
 
标注出来的尺寸比较杂乱,框选所有尺寸,鼠标【右键】-【对齐】-【自动排列】。

2. 定义图纸格式

右击工程图纸上的空白区域,或者右击特征管理器设计树中的“图纸格式”,在弹出的快捷菜单中选择“编辑图纸格式”命令。
双击标题栏中的文字,即可修改。同时,在“注释”属性管理器的“文字格式”栏中可以修改对齐方式、文字旋转角度和字体等属性,也可以在系统弹出的“格式化”对话框中修改这些属性(如图)
 
在特征管理器设计树中右击“图纸”图标[插图],在弹出的快捷菜单中选择“属性”命令。在弹出的“图纸属性”对话框中进行如下设定(如图)

3. 创建标准三视图
标准三视图是指从三维模型的前视、右视、上视3个正交角度投影生成3个正交视图(如图)

1.打开零件或装配体模型文件,创建标准三视图
2.不打开零件或装配体模型文件,生成标准三视图
3.利用Internet Explorer中的超文本链接生成标准三视图
4. 创建模型视图
操作步骤如下。
 (1)单击“视图布局”面板中的“模型视图”按钮[插图]。
 (2)与生成标准三视图中选择模型的方法一样,在零件或装配体文件中选择一个模型。
 (3)回到工程图文件中,鼠标指针变为[插图]形状。
 (4)在“模型视图”属性管理器的“方向”栏中选择视图的投影方向。
 (5)在工程图中选择合适位置,单击放置模型视图,如图。

(6)如果要更改模型视图的投影方向,则单击“方向”栏中的视图方向。
 (7)如果要更改模型视图的显示比例,则在“比例”栏中选中“使用自定义比例”单选按钮,然后输入显示比例。
 (8)单击“确定”按钮[插图],完成模型视图的插入。
5. 创建视图
5.1 剖面视图
5.1.1 简单剖视图
剖面视图是指用一条剖切线分割工程图中的一个视图,然后从垂直于生成的剖面方向投影得到的视图,如图
 
5.1.2 旋转剖视图
旋转剖视图中的剖切线由两条具有一定角度的线段组成。系统垂直于剖切方向投影生成剖面视图,如图

5.2 投影视图
投影视图是从正交方向对现有视图投影生成的视图,如图

5.3 辅助视图
辅助视图类似于投影视图,其投影方向垂直于所选视图的参考边线,如图

5.4 局部视图
可以在工程图中生成一个局部视图,来放大显示视图中的某个部分,如图

5.5 断裂视图
工程图中有一些截面相同的长杆件(如长轴、螺纹杆等),这些零件在某个方向的尺寸比其他方向的尺寸大很多,而且截面没有变化。此时可以利用断裂视图将零件用较大比例显示在工程图上,如图

6. 注解的标注
如果在三维零件模型或装配体中添加了尺寸、注释或符号,则在将三维模型转换为二维工程图纸的过程中,系统会将这些尺寸、注释等一起添加到图纸中。在工程图中,用户可以添加必要的参考尺寸、注解等,这些参考尺寸和注解不会影响零件或装配体文件。
工程图中的尺寸标注是与模型相关联的,模型中的更改会反映在工程图中。通常用户在生成每个零件特征时生成尺寸,然后将这些尺寸插入各个工程视图中。在模型中更改尺寸会更新工程图;反之,在工程图中更改插入的尺寸也会更改模型。用户可以在工程图文件中添加尺寸,但是这些尺寸是参考尺寸,并且是从动尺寸。参考尺寸显示模型的测量值,但并不驱动模型,也不能更改其数值。但是当更改模型时,参考尺寸会相应更新。当压缩特征时,特征的参考尺寸也随之被压缩。
默认情况下,插入的尺寸显示为黑色,包括零件或装配体文件中显示为蓝色的尺寸(如拉伸深度);参考尺寸显示为灰色,并带有括号。
6.1 注释
为了更好地说明工程图,有时要用到注释,如图。注释可以包括简单的文字、符号或超文本链接。

 
6.2 表面粗糙度
表面粗糙度符号用来表示加工表面上的微观几何形状特性,对于机械零件表面的耐磨性、疲劳强度、配合性能、密封性、流体阻力及外观质量等都有很大的影响。

6.3 形位公差
形位公差(如图)是机械加工工业中一项非常重要的基础,尤其是在精密机器和仪表的加工中,形位公差是评定产品质量的重要技术指标之一。它对于在高速、高压、高温、重载等条件下工作的产品零件的精度、性能和寿命等有较大的影响。
形位公差举例:
 
“符号”面板
 
 “属性”对话框

6.4 基准特征符号
基准特征符号用来表示模型平面或参考基准面,如图所示。

操作步骤如下。
(1)单击“注解”面板上的“基准特征”按钮[插图]。
 (2)在弹出的“基准特征”属性管理器(如图)中设置属性。
 (3)在图形区域中单击,以放置符号。
 (4)可以不关闭对话框,设置多个基准特征符号到图形上。
 (5)单击“确定”按钮[插图],完成基准特征符号的标注。
7. 分离工程图
分离格式的工程图无须将三维模型文件装入内存,即可打开并编辑;用户可以将RapidDraft工程图传送给其他的SOLIDWORKS用户而不传送模型文件;分离工程图的视图在模型的更新方面也有更多的控制。当设计组的设计员编辑模型时,其他的设计员可以独立地在工程图中进行操作,对工程图添加细节及注解。由于内存中没有装入模型文件,以分离模式打开工程图的时间将大幅缩短。因为模型数据未被保存在内存中,所以有更多的内存可以用来处理工程图数据,这对大型装配体工程图来说是很大的性能改善。
单击“标准”工具栏中的“打开”按钮,在“打开”对话框中选择要转换为分离格式的工程图。单击“打开”按钮,打开工程图。单击“保存”按钮,选择“保存类型”为“分离的工程图”,如图8-47所示。保存并关闭文件。
 
在分离格式的工程图中进行编辑的方法与普通格式的工程图中基本相同。
参考资料
- [1] 【B站】Solidworks转工程图
- [2] 《SOLIDWORKS 2018中文版从入门到精通》8.3创建标准三视图
相关文章:
 
SolidWorks 入门笔记03:生成工程图和一键标注
默认情况下,SOLIDWORKS系统在工程图和零件或装配体三维模型之间提供全相关的功能,全相关意味着无论什么时候修改零件或装配体的三维模型,所有相关的工程视图将自动更新,以反映零件或装配体的形状和尺寸变化;反之&#…...
 
【Java】对象内存图多个对象同一内存地址
目录 学生类 单个对象内存图 多个对象指向同一个内存地址 学生类 Student.java如下: package com.面向对象;public class Student {String name;int age;public void work() {System.out.println("开始敲代码...");} }StudentDemo.java如下ÿ…...
Python 笔记05(装饰器的使用)
一 装饰器的使用 (property) property 是 Python 中用于创建属性的装饰器。它的作用是将一个类方法转换为类属性,从而可以像 访问属性一样访问该方法,而不需要使用函数调用的语法。使用 property 主要有以下好处: 封装性和隐藏实现细节&…...
记忆化搜索,901. 滑雪
901. 滑雪 - AcWing题库 给定一个 R 行 C 列的矩阵,表示一个矩形网格滑雪场。 矩阵中第 i行第 j 列的点表示滑雪场的第 i 行第 j列区域的高度。 一个人从滑雪场中的某个区域内出发,每次可以向上下左右任意一个方向滑动一个单位距离。 当然࿰…...
计算机网络:连接世界的纽带
计算机网络的基础概念 计算机网络是一组相互连接的计算机,它们通过通信链路和协议进行数据交换和资源共享。以下是一些关键概念: 1. 节点和主机 网络中的计算机设备称为节点,通常是主机或服务器。主机是普通用户或终端设备,而服…...
SpringMVC 学习(三)注解开发
4. 注解开发 4.1 环境搭建 (1) 新建 maven 模块 springmvc-03-annotation (2) 确认依赖 确认方法同 3(2),手动导入发布依赖见3(11) <!--资源过滤--> <build><resources><resource><directory>src/main/java</directory>&…...
 
0x84加密数据传输服务
为了在安全模式下实现一些诊断服务,在服务端和客户端应用程序之间添加了Security sub-layer。在客户端与服务端之间进行诊断服务数据传输有两种方法: 1、非安全模式下数据传输 应用程序使用诊断服务(diagnostic Services)和应用层服务原语(Applicati…...
Vue.js快速入门:构建现代Web应用
Vue Vue.js是一款流行的JavaScript框架,用于构建现代的、交互式的Web应用程序。它具有简单易学的特点,同时也非常强大,能够帮助开发者构建高效、可维护的前端应用。本篇博客将带你快速入门Vue.js,并演示如何构建一个简单的Vue应用…...
Scala第五章节
Scala第五章节 scala总目录 章节目标 掌握方法的格式和用法掌握函数的格式和用法掌握九九乘法表案例 1. 方法 1.1 概述 实际开发中, 我们需要编写大量的逻辑代码, 这就势必会涉及到重复的需求. 例如: 求10和20的最大值, 求11和22的最大值, 像这样的需求, 用来进行比较的逻…...
erlang练习题(三)
题目一 查询列表A是否为列表B的前缀 解答 isPrefix([], List2) -> io:format("A is prefix of B ~n");isPrefix([H1 | ListA], [H2 | ListB]) ->case H1 H2 oftrue -> isPrefix(ListA, ListB);false -> io:format("A is not prefix of B ~n&quo…...
What Is A DNS Amplification DDoS Attack?
什么是 DNS 放大攻击? 域名系统 (DNS) 是用于在网站的机器可读地址(例如 191.168.0.1:80)和人类可读名称(例如 radware.com)之间进行解析的目录在 DNS 放大攻击中,攻击者…...
jvm笔记
好处: 跨平台 内存管理机制,垃圾回收功能 数组下标越界检查 多态 名词解释: jvm java虚拟机,是java程序的运行环境 jre jvm基础类库 jdk jre编译工具 javase jdkide工具 javaee javase应用服务器 jvm的内存结构: 程序…...
 
WPF中的控件
内容控件:label、border Window控件 Label控件 Border控件 内容控件 Button控件 点击取消按钮关闭程序;点击登录按钮打开BorderWindow窗口。 TextBox控件 PasswordBox控件 TextBlock控件 加载窗口时显示TextBlock中的内容 RadioButton控件 CheckBox控件…...
 
Java下对象的序列化和反序列化(写出和读入)
代码如下: public class MyWork {public static void main(String[] args) throws IOException, ClassNotFoundException {//序列化File f new File("testFile/testObject.txt");ObjectOutputStream oos new ObjectOutputStream(new FileOutputStream(…...
 
基于springboot的洗衣店订单管理系统
目录 前言 一、技术栈 二、系统功能介绍 顾客信息管理 店家信息管理 店铺信息管理 洗衣信息管理 预约功能 洗衣信息 交流区 三、核心代码 1、登录模块 2、文件上传模块 3、代码封装 前言 随着信息互联网信息的飞速发展,无纸化作业变成了一种趋势&#x…...
Llama2部署踩坑
1、权重是.bin,但是报错找不到.safetensors 明明权重文件是.bin,但是却提示我缺少.safetensors。最后发现好像是 llama2-7b这个模型文件不行,必须要llama2-7b-chat这个模型才能读取的通,具体原因还暂不明确。...
 
Adams齿轮副
1.运动副 添加旋转副的时候,必须先物体后公共part(即此处的ground),最后再选择质心点 2.啮合点 啮合点marker的z轴必须是齿轮分度圆的切线方向 3.啮合点 两齿轮的旋转副,和啮合点,即cv marker ,必须属…...
Elasticsearch keyword 中的 ignore_above配置项
1. ignore_above 关于es mapping的keyword ignore_above配置项的解释如下: Do not index any string longer than this value. Defaults to 2147483647 so that all values would be accepted. 不会索引大于ignore_above配置值的数据,默认值2147483647字…...
RabbitMQ原理(一):基础知识
文章目录 1.初识MQ1.1.同步调用1.2.异步调用1.3.技术选型2.RabbitMQ2.1.安装2.2.收发消息2.2.1.交换机2.2.2.队列2.2.3.绑定关系2.2.4.发送消息2.3.数据隔离2.3.1.用户管理2.3.2.virtual host微服务一旦拆分,必然涉及到服务之间的相互调用,目前我们服务之间调用采用的都是基于…...
 
[Linux]Git
文章摘于GitHub博主geeeeeeeeek 文章目录 1.1 Git 简易指南创建新仓库工作流添加与提交推送改动 1.2 创建代码仓库git init用法讨论裸仓库 例子 git clone用法讨论仓库间协作 例子用法讨论栗子 1.3 保存你的更改git add用法讨论缓存区 栗子 git commit用法讨论记录快照…...
 
Python实现prophet 理论及参数优化
文章目录 Prophet理论及模型参数介绍Python代码完整实现prophet 添加外部数据进行模型优化 之前初步学习prophet的时候,写过一篇简单实现,后期随着对该模型的深入研究,本次记录涉及到prophet 的公式以及参数调优,从公式可以更直观…...
 
HBuilderX安装(uni-app和小程序开发)
下载HBuilderX 访问官方网站:https://www.dcloud.io/hbuilderx.html 根据您的操作系统选择合适版本: Windows版(推荐下载标准版) Windows系统安装步骤 运行安装程序: 双击下载的.exe安装文件 如果出现安全提示&…...
【服务器压力测试】本地PC电脑作为服务器运行时出现卡顿和资源紧张(Windows/Linux)
要让本地PC电脑作为服务器运行时出现卡顿和资源紧张的情况,可以通过以下几种方式模拟或触发: 1. 增加CPU负载 运行大量计算密集型任务,例如: 使用多线程循环执行复杂计算(如数学运算、加密解密等)。运行图…...
大学生职业发展与就业创业指导教学评价
这里是引用 作为软工2203/2204班的学生,我们非常感谢您在《大学生职业发展与就业创业指导》课程中的悉心教导。这门课程对我们即将面临实习和就业的工科学生来说至关重要,而您认真负责的教学态度,让课程的每一部分都充满了实用价值。 尤其让我…...
 
Map相关知识
数据结构 二叉树 二叉树,顾名思义,每个节点最多有两个“叉”,也就是两个子节点,分别是左子 节点和右子节点。不过,二叉树并不要求每个节点都有两个子节点,有的节点只 有左子节点,有的节点只有…...
 
手机平板能效生态设计指令EU 2023/1670标准解读
手机平板能效生态设计指令EU 2023/1670标准解读 以下是针对欧盟《手机和平板电脑生态设计法规》(EU) 2023/1670 的核心解读,综合法规核心要求、最新修正及企业合规要点: 一、法规背景与目标 生效与强制时间 发布于2023年8月31日(OJ公报&…...
 
uniapp 小程序 学习(一)
利用Hbuilder 创建项目 运行到内置浏览器看效果 下载微信小程序 安装到Hbuilder 下载地址 :开发者工具默认安装 设置服务端口号 在Hbuilder中设置微信小程序 配置 找到运行设置,将微信开发者工具放入到Hbuilder中, 打开后出现 如下 bug 解…...
HTML前端开发:JavaScript 获取元素方法详解
作为前端开发者,高效获取 DOM 元素是必备技能。以下是 JS 中核心的获取元素方法,分为两大系列: 一、getElementBy... 系列 传统方法,直接通过 DOM 接口访问,返回动态集合(元素变化会实时更新)。…...
小木的算法日记-多叉树的递归/层序遍历
🌲 从二叉树到森林:一文彻底搞懂多叉树遍历的艺术 🚀 引言 你好,未来的算法大神! 在数据结构的世界里,“树”无疑是最核心、最迷人的概念之一。我们中的大多数人都是从 二叉树 开始入门的,它…...
 
spring Security对RBAC及其ABAC的支持使用
RBAC (基于角色的访问控制) RBAC (Role-Based Access Control) 是 Spring Security 中最常用的权限模型,它将权限分配给角色,再将角色分配给用户。 RBAC 核心实现 1. 数据库设计 users roles permissions ------- ------…...
